Fast Charging, Ever Reliable October 31, 2008 This came with my Rebel XT. Made in Japan, rated at 720mAH. I also bought a generic battery (SterlingTek - made in China) for back-up. Generic battery is rated to be 1700mA. Canon's probably last 100 shots more for comparison.
Pros: - A full charge usually lasts around 500 shots. Auto focusing on all the time and with a 15% flash use. - Amazingly small and light. It fits even in the smallest pocket of your camera bag. - It is Canon for your Canon. You know there is no incompatibility issue. Perfect fit. - Fast charging. 1 hour of charge will lasts you a full day of shooting.
Cons: - Expensive compared to my back-up that costs almost 1/4 of the price. Both batteries still works.

Cheaper is NOT Better... Stick with Canon Brand October 18, 2008 I purchased an off-brand battery for my Canon Rebel XT a few months ago from a local dealer. After using it for about 3 months, it would charge up in 10 minutes and wouldn't stay charged for more than 5 shots. I was furious.
My Canon NB-2LH Rechargeable Battery Pack, however, stays charged for 1000s of shots and takes less than 2 hours to fully charge. Although it is quite a bit more expensive than the one I bought previously, its reliability was worth the money.
